Official: Manchester United sign Andrey Santos from Chelsea
Andrey Santos has completed his £50m move to Manchester United, which was agreed last week. The 22-year-old midfielder has signed a five-year contract at Old Trafford. Official: Everton sign Tyrique George from Chelsea
Tyrique George’s transfer to Everton has been made official today, with the 20-year-old joining on a four-year contract good through 2030. Everton are reportedly paying £24m, though that’s inclusive of the potential £6m in add-ons and bonuses, unlike initially reported (i.e. the fee was initially reported at £24+6m, but it’s instead £18+6m).
